Tickled, GFT, 26 – 28 August, 2016

A thrilling stranger-than-fiction documentary.
Friday 26 – Sunday 28 August
Running time: 1h32m
Journalist David Farrier stumbles upon a “competitive endurance tickling” video online, wherein young men are paid to be tied up and tickled. Farrier reaches out to request an interview with the production company, but receives an abusive response threatening extreme legal action should he dig any deeper. Spurred on by the resistance, Farrier investigates further and soon uncovers a twisted story of a vast empire built on bullying and criminal activity. A thrilling documentary unravelling a web of lies and deceit from the dark corners of the Internet.
Director David Farrier, Dylan Reeve
New Zealand 2016, 1h32m, 15
